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. Variant got 7 ACMG points: 7P and 0B. PM1PM2PM5PP3

The NM_014222.3(NDUFA8):c.140G>A(p.Arg47His)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000041 in 1,461,882 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. R47C) has been classified as Pathogenic.

Genes affected
NDUFA8 (HGNC:7692): (NADH:ubiquinone oxidoreductase subunit A8) The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the complex I 19 kDa subunit family. Mammalian complex I is composed of 45 different subunits. This protein has NADH dehydrogenase activity and oxidoreductase activity. It plays an important role in transfering electrons from NADH to the respiratory chain. The immediate electron acceptor for the enzyme is believed to be ubiquinone. Alternative splicing of this gene results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2015]

Submissions by phenotype

not specified Uncertain:1
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sApr 27, 2023The c.140G>A (p.R47H) alteration is located in exon 2 (coding exon 2) of the NDUFA8 gene. This alteration results from a G to A substitution at nucleotide position 140, causing the arginine (R) at amino acid position 47 to be replaced by a histidine (H).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
